Tennis scores first, Warner nets her 10th in Falcons’ win over Notre Dame of Maryland

BALTIMORE, Mary. --- The Cedar Crest College Soccer squad took down the Gators from Notre Dame of Maryland 2-0 Saturday afternoon.
 
The Falcons, now 7-3 and 2-1 in Colonial States Athletic Conference competition, got on the board early today. Scoring in the 7th minute was sophomore Adrianna Tennis (Pine Grove, Pa./Pine Grove ), netting her fourth goal of the year that was assisted by junior Kelsey Kehm (Trappe, Pa./Perkiomen Valley ). The Black and Yellow would score another goal in the 28th minute off the foot of sophomore Daria Warner (Harrisburg, Pa./Bishop McDevitt) for her 10th goal of the season.
 
Senior goalkeeper Morgan Maddock (Brick, N.J./Brick Memorial High School) earned the win in today's contest, making four saves in 90:00 minutes of action. Maddock improves to 7-3 on the year.
 
The Falcons blasted 27 shots with 17 of them being on net, compared to the seven total shots taken by the Gators, four that went on the keeper were saved. Cedar Crest earned three corner kicks to Notre Dame's one.
 
Cedar Crest will return to action on Tuesday, October 2 when they host Colonial States Athletic Conference opponent Bryn Athyn College for a 7:00 PM start time on the FalconPlex.
